Exxon
2611 N Central Ave, Chicago, IL 60639
Get gas near you at the Exxon on 2611 N Central Ave in Chicago,IL
More Business Info
- Hours
- Regular Hours
Mon - Sun: - Other Link
https://www.exxon.com/en/find-station/exxon-chicago-il-northcentralmart-200330166
- Categories
- Gas Stations, Convenience Stores